Medical personnel at the Buffalo VA
Medical Center failed to try to resuscitate a
patient suffering cardiac arrest
in late 2016, pronouncing him dead even though they should have tried to save his life, the Department of Veterans Affairs Inspector General's
Office said
in a devastating report that recommended sweeping improvements
in the facility's practices during life - or - death emergencies.

To estimate the number of new
patients in a given year, the Department used the National Ambulatory
Medical Care Survey and the National Hospital Ambulatory
Medical Care Survey, which indicate that for ambulatory care visits to physician
offices and hospital ambulatory care departments, 13 percent of all
patients are new.

• Report to clinical coordinator or practice administrator • Perform nursing procedures under supervision of physician or physician assistant • Assist physician and physician assistant
in exam rooms • Escort
patients to exam rooms, interviews
patients, measure vital signs, including weight, blood pressure, pulse, temperature, and document all information
in patient's chart • Give instructions to
patients as instructed by physician or physician assistant • Ensure all related reports, labs and information is filed is available
in patients»
medical records prior to their appointment • Keep exam rooms stocked with adequate
medical supplies, maintain instruments, prepare sterilization as required • Take telephone messages and provide feedback and answers to
patient / physician / pharmacy calls • Triage and process messages from
patients and front
office staff to physicians and physician assistants • Maintain all logs and required checks (i.e. refrigerator temperatures, emergency medications, expired medications, oxygen, cold sterilization fluid change, etc.) • All other duties as assigned by clinical coordinator or practice administrator
